Writing an effective letter to request a seat change in class involves being clear and polite. Start with a respectful salutation and introduce yourself, mentioning your name, class, and roll number. Clearly state the purpose of your letter, including your current seat and the desired seat. Explain the reason for your request. Conclude by politely asking for consideration and approval. Avoid unclear language and ensure you include all necessary details to prevent any misunderstandings.
Sample Letter for Seat Change in Class
To,
The Class Teacher,
_______ (School Name)
_______ (School Address)
Date: __/__/____ (Date)
Subject: Request for change of seat
Sir/Madam,
Most courteously, I would like to inform that I am _________ (Name) and I am a student of ________ (class) having roll number _______ (mention your roll number).
I am writing this letter in order to request you for changing my seat. I am currently allotted with seat number/ bench number ____________ (mention) and I request you to kindly change it to _________ (mention). The reason behind the same is _________ (mention reason).
I believe, you would consider this as a genuine request.
Yours obediently,
_________ (Name of the student)
_________ (class)
_________ (roll number)
